Literature 1
Second Grade
Reading
This literature lesson guides kids towards a deeper understanding of second grade texts through an exploration of character, setting, and plot. Kids will be challenged to answer the who, what, where, when and why of a story, in addition to determining the story's message. Two versions of the same story will be presented in order for second graders to see story elements in action.

Typing Home Row 2
First Grade
Typing
The home row refers to the center row of a keyboard. New typers use the homerow as a point of reference for how to position their hands when they are using a computer. This lesson will help your students learn how to type letters in the home row with accuracy, fluency, and even a little bit of fun.

Place Value 3
Second Grade
Addition
Learning three-digit numbers can be a challenging part of the math curriculum for many second graders. This lesson helps to support second graders' understanding of larger numbers by teaching them place value. Kids will compare three-digit numbers and learn to count up to 1000 with guided instruction.
